Take care of your laptop battery and ensure that it will be ready to work properly when you need it most. Some general tips for laptop care include: avoid extreme temperatures, don't leave a laptop outside in cold weather or leave it in a hot car. Cold batteries can't create very much power and hot batteries will discharge very quickly. Use electrical power when available to keep battery charged. Don't let your laptop go for long periods of time without using the battery.

Battery life :
Battery life can be extended by storing the batteries at a low temperature, as in a refrigerator or freezer, because the chemical reactions in the batteries are slower. Such storage can extend the life of alkaline batteries by ~5%; while the charge of rechargeable batteries can be extended from a few days up to several months.[64] In order to reach their maximum voltage, batteries must be returned to room temperature; therefore, alkaline battery manufacturers like Duracell do not recommend refrigerating or freezing batteries.
Battery charge and discharge
When charging the battery for the first time your charging device may indicate that charging is complete after just 10 or 15 minutes. This is a normal phenomenon with rechargeable batteries. Simply remove the battery from the charging device and repeat the charging procedure.
It is important to condition (fully discharge and then fully charge) the battery every two to three weeks. Failure to do so may significantly shorten the battery's life (this does not apply to Li-Ion batteries, which do not require conditioning). To discharge, simply run your device under the battery's power until it shuts down or until you get a low battery warning. Then recharge the battery as instructed in your user's manual.
Battery Store :
Keep battery away from fire or other sources of extreme heat. Do not incinerate. Exposure of battery to extreme heat may result in an explosion.
Battery Storage - If you don't plan on using the battery for a month or more, we recommend storing it in a clean, dry, cool place away from heat and metal objects. Ni-Cd, Ni-MH and Li-Ion batteries will self-discharge during storage; remember to break them in before use.
Do not short-circuit. A short-circuit may cause severe damage to the battery.
Do not drop, hit or otherwise abuse the battery as this may result in the exposure of the cell contents, which are corrosive.

Battery maintain :
Keep Your Batteries Clean - it's a good idea to clean dirty battery contacts with a cotton swab and alcohol. This helps maintain a good connection between the battery and your laptop.
Exercise Your Battery - Do not leave your battery dormant for long periods of time. We recommend using the battery at least once every two to three weeks. If a battery has not been used for a long period of time, perform the new battery break in procedure described above.
1.What is a Battery?
In science and technology, a battery is a device that stores energy and makes it available in an electrical form. It converts chemical energy into electrical energy, producing an electric current when connected in a circuit. The finished battery is an electrically connected group of cells (wired in series) that stores an electrical charge and supplies a direct current (DC). We usually call finished battery as battery pack and unfinished battery is called as cell.

3.What are the differences between Primary Battery and rechargeable battery?
A primary battery is not intended to be recharged and is discarded when the battery has delivered all of its electrical energy.
A rechargeable battery is a galvanic battery which, after discharge, is restored to the fully charged state by the passage of an electrical current through the cell in the opposite direction to that of discharge.
